Strongsville, OH - March 19th - 22nd - R.O.A.R. On-Road Carpet Nationals


We just got back from the 2009 On-Road Carpet Nationals, and we had a blast.

The Gate (in Cleveland) was originally going to hold the race, but it was flooded during a Winter storm. Instead of giving up on the event, the Gate crew put in a ton of work, and moved the race to the Holiday Inn in Strongsville, Ohio. Just a few minutes from the Airport.

Talk about turning Lemons into Lemonade, these guys turned Lemons into Long Island Ice Teas!

The facility turned out to be great, with by far the most friendly hotel staff I think we've ever dealt with. The hotel was clean and they served food.....real food until 1:30AM! That might not seem like a big deal, but if you haven't been to a big race before, eating at Denny's or the McDonald's drive thru at midnight after a 16 hour day isn't as glamorous as it seems.

The Gate crew with help from Terry Rott (and others I'm sure), laid down a super track. It had a few bumps, but nothing that we haven't raced on before, and as the week went on, the track smoothed out quite a bit. we were also lucky enough to have John Cattracala from Fast Cats up in Canada come down and share his technical expertise as well as two projectors that helped the on-lookers follow the racing action.

Because this was a ROAR National, the ROAR race team came out to help run the race. Ruben Benitez got behind the mic, Billy Bowerman made sure the racing was clean and fair, while Bob Ingersol helped out in tech which was both fast and efficient. Our ROAR president Dawn Sanchez even flew out, which was great. A lot of us had never met her, and it was nice to see her at an On-Road race. All in all, ROAR did a superb job, and really gained a lot of respect with a lot of on-road racers and Mfg's.

How'd the race go for SpeedMerchant??? Just great.....we won our 25th National title with Mike Dumas piloting his Rev.5 to the win in the 13.5 class. Mike also had a top 3 finish in World GT. We were hoping to defend Mike's Modified title (he won Mod in 2007 & 2008), but we had speed control failures in 2 out of 3 of the A-Mains. The one A Main he did finish was a great battle between him & Blackstock for the win.

Donny Lia also had an excellent showing at the Nats. Donny has absolutely dominated the 17.5 class this season. He won EVERY big race there was, including the IIC in Vegas, the Indoor Champs in Cleveland, and the Snowbird Nationals in Florida. Usually when a driver moves up from 17.5 Stock to Modified, it takes a season or two to break into the A-Main at a National level race. Not Donny...... his 1st modified race, and he put his Rev.5 solidly in the Modified A-Main in one of the most competitive fields in a long time. Donny also made the A-Main in 13.5 class as well as World GT! Just a great job by a very talented racer.
